  • Title

    Analysis and Simulation of the Effects of Controlled Water Heaters in a Winter Peaking System

  • Abstract
    Electrical utilities in North America have shown a recent interest in load management. The management of air conditioning in sumrmer peaking systems and the management of water heaters in a winter peaking system are constantly discussed. This work considers the latter aspect. Some field tests have been reported in the literature. This paper develops, with some judgement and approximation, a mathematical model. The results obtained indicate the relation between the several variables in the process and the sensitivity of the peak reduction to the input parameters. The model can be used in a semi-interactive way as a planning tool to study the effect of load management. The resulting reserve reduction and the number of days of desired load management have been indicated for an example system.
